People are assuming Vance would be the nominee, but he hadn’t been announced as the VP at the time of the assassination attempt. The Republican Convention was the very next week. If Trump was assassinated, perhaps they would have delayed it a few weeks, but the delegates at that convention would have chosen the nominee. The finale 3 VP candidates were Rubio, Doug Burgum and Vance, so they may have a leg up on other candidates. Nikki Haley and DeSantis would be unlikely becuase they just lost to Trump in the primary. The wildcard would be if one of the trump kids (most likely Don Jr) put their name into the ring. At the end of the day I’d guess Rubio would be the Republican nominee, but who knows.

Also, Joe Biden was still in the race at the time (but was under pressure to drop out). Depending on what the Republicans do, maybe he stays in the race (for example if his opponent was going to be Don Jr). Even if he does drop out, maybe the Dems opt for the nominee to be chosen at their convention instead of crowning Harris. The Republicans would have just chosen their candidate at a convention, so the precedent would be there.

In this scenario, let’s say the Dems nominate Gavin Newsom, and we have Newsom vs Rubio, which is a very close election which I’ll give to Newsom, assuming the Trump coalition doesn’t turn out to vote for Rubio and the Dem electorate is more energized to vote for a fresh face as opposed to Biden’s VP
